Technical Specifications: DPP-260 Capsule Blister Packing Machine
Precision-engineered for pharmaceutical excellence. Every parameter is designed to meet the most stringent global standards.
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Performance Capabilities | |
| Model | DPP-260 |
| Production Capacity | Up to 14,000 blisters/hour (single punch); Up to 28,000 blisters/hour (double punch) |
| Max. Forming Area | 260 × 150 mm (10.2" × 5.9") |
| Max. Forming Depth | 26 mm (1.02") for PVC; 18 mm (0.71") for Alu-Alu |
| Stroke Frequency | 10 - 40 cycles/min (variable speed, frequency-controlled) |
| Noise Level | < 75 dB(A) during operation |
| Material & Film Specifications | |
| Forming Film (Base) | PVC: 0.15 - 0.50 mm; PVDC: 0.15 - 0.30 mm; Alu: 0.06 - 0.12 mm |
| Sealing Film (Lidding) | Alu: 0.02 - 0.035 mm; Paper/Alu/PE composite |
| Max. Film Width | 280 mm (11.0") |
| Sealing Method | Flat-plate heat sealing with independent temperature control (PID) |
| Contact Parts Material | SS316L (Stainless Steel, GMP compliant) |
| Electrical & Power Requirements | |
| Power Supply | 380V / 50Hz, 3-Phase (or 220V / 60Hz, customizable) |
| Total Power | 12 kW |
| Compressed Air | 0.6 - 0.8 MPa (6-8 bar), consumption: ~600 L/min |
| Control System | Siemens PLC + 10" color HMI touchscreen |
| Dimensions & Weight | |
| Machine Dimensions (L × W × H) | 3400 × 980 × 1650 mm (133.9" × 38.6" × 65.0") |
| Net Weight | Approx. 2,800 kg (6,173 lbs) |
| Compliance & Certifications | |
| Standards | cGMP, CE Certified, ISO 9001:2015 |
| Data Integrity | 21 CFR Part 11 Ready (electronic signature, audit trail) |
| Documentation | Full IQ/OQ/PQ protocols, FAT/SAT available, detailed Operation & Maintenance Manuals |

Material Capabilities: From Standard PVC to High-Barrier Alu-Alu
Choose the right packaging material to match your product's stability requirements, market positioning, and regulatory demands.
P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ride)
The industry standard for cost-effective blister packaging. Excellent clarity for product visibility. Ideal for stable, non-hygroscopic products with moderate shelf-life requirements.
Most EconomicalPVDC (Polyvinylidene Chloride)
Enhanced barrier protection against moisture and oxygen. A significant upgrade from standard PVC. Perfect for hygroscopic tablets and capsules requiring extended shelf life in humid climates.
Enhanced ProtectionAlu-Alu (Cold-Form Aluminum)
The premium choice for high-value, light-sensitive, or moisture-sensitive APIs. Provides an absolute barrier to light, oxygen, and water vapor. Mandatory for many biologics and advanced therapies.

What's the difference between a flat-plate and a roller-type machine?
Roller-type machines use a drum for forming and sealing, offering high speed but with limitations on forming depth and mold flexibility. Our DPP-260 is a flat-plate type. This design provides superior forming quality, deeper pockets, and allows for more complex, customized blister layouts. It's the preferred choice for pharmaceutical-grade applications where precision and flexibility are critical.
How does your machine handle dusty or friable tablets?
This is a critical challenge we've engineered for. The DPP-260 features a specialized brush-box feeding system designed to handle delicate products with minimal breakage. Furthermore, we've integrated dedicated dust extraction ports at key points to remove fine particles before the sealing station, ensuring a perfect, clean seal every time.
What is Alu-Alu packaging and does this machine support it?
Yes, the DPP-260 is fully capable of Alu-Alu (Cold Form) packaging. Alu-Alu uses a laminate of aluminum film for both the base and the lid, creating a complete barrier against light, moisture, and oxygen. This is essential for highly sensitive or high-value drugs. Our machine's robust frame and precision tooling are specifically designed to handle the higher pressures required for cold forming.
